Inside Scoop: China to Optimize Cosmetic Safety Assessment Management

According to an unofficial draft document currently circulating in the industry, the proposed optimization measures for safety assessment encompass the following key points: 1) Introduction of a six-month transition period; 2) Enhancement of technical guidance; 3) Integration of ingredient data resources; 4) Implementation of a classified management system for assessment reports.

Background

As per the Technical Guidelines for Cosmetic Safety Assessment, until May 1, 2024, registrants and notifiers of cosmetics have the option to submit a simplified version of the product safety assessment report during product registration or notification process. However, starting from May 1, 2024, registrants and notifiers should submit the full version of safety assessment report. Due to difficulties such as the lack of toxicological data for various ingredients and the shortage of safety assessment personnel, the shift to the full version of the safety assessment report presents a challenge for the industry.

 

According to the official industry newspaper of National Medical Products Administration (NMPA) on March 15, 2024, NMPA is organizing research and formulating multiple measures to optimize the management of cosmetics safety assessment.

Recently, an unofficial draft document titled "Several Measures to Optimize Cosmetic Safety Assessment Management" is widely circulating and sparking extensive discussion in the industry. Key information of the document includes the proposal of a six-month transition period, as well as various optimization measures concerning the ingredient safety database and the submission system for safety assessment reports. It is crucial to note that this document is not the official version. The final document to be issued by NMPA will take precedence.
